America 250 Planning Committee Discussion  
1.  
Events by Month  
July 2025  
o Ledyard Celebrates America 250 Kickoff Event - 4th of July Celebration at the Nathan  
Lester House  
August 2025  
o Banners in front of Town Hall  
September 2025  
o Voting Sticker Design Contest in Elementary Schools  
· Patty is in contact with elementary schools  
· Kristen will create a contest template for distribution in schools  
· 12 finalists to present to Town Council on 9/10  
o Article in events magazine with QR code to town website  
October 2025  
o History Day at Bill Library - October 4th - 11:30 a.m.  
· Presentation by Matt Novasad “Ledyard and the War of 1812”  
o Cemetery Tours  
· Cemetery Committee (Doug & Kate) - October 17th rain date 18th @ 5:00 p.m.  
Ø Register through Parks & Rec (free ticket)  
November 2025  
o Veteran’s Day Tribute - America 250 Themed Veteran Yard Signs (Kate & Kristen)  
December 2025  
o Yuletide Celebration @Nathan Lester House - December 7th (Doug)  
o Historical Baking Contest - December 17th @ 6:30 (Matt to organize Library event with  
cookbook club)  
· Pies, Cakes, Custards & Syllabub (American Cookery 1796 - First American  
published cookbook)  
o Hometown Hero’s Ceremony - Dinner Senior Center - December 12th @ 5:30 pm (Scott)  
· $10 ticket  
· Mayor Allyn will present the “Quilt of Valor”  
o Beautification Committee - Bulb Planting Committee will plant red, white and blue  
crocus to spell “America 250”  
· Gales Ferry School has been planted  
· Ledyard - Bill Library - mulch area  
January 2026  
February 2026  
o Historical Maps & Roaming Exhibit  
· 10 easels have been ordered  
· Kate is finalizing posters  
o Larry Erhart - Colonial Money Presentation - Bill Library - Feb 12 @ 6:00 pm  
March 2026  
o Color Fun Run - America 250 theme - March 28th (Scott)  
· Checking with school & PD for date approval  
o Women’s History Month Traveling Exhibit  
· Kate working on choosing 5 women for this exhibit  
· Work with Libraries & Schools to display  
April 2026  
o Arbor Day Tree Planting - plant an Oak Tree in Town (Mayor Allyn)  
May 2026  
o Memorial Day Parade “America 250 Float”  
· Parade walkers in colonial dress  
· Councilor Lamb working to provide old farm tractor and/or trailer  
· Councilor Lamb & Doug to provide colonel clothing for walker/walkers  
June 2026  
o Flag Day Celebration (Flag Retirement Ceremony - Boy Scouts)  
July 4, 2026 (Rain Date, July 5th)  
o P& R Summer Camp “Celebrate 250” theme week  
o Celebration Nathan Lester House  
· Reenactors (Matt contacting groups, 5-10 people?; Doug to facilitate site visit)  
· Historical Games (Doug)  
· Awards for Community Group Events  
· Commemorative Coin (Mayor getting info from Larry Erhart)  
· Live Music  
· Bury Time Capsule  
· Colonial Crafts (Doug)  
· Historical Society on board to assist with event  
· Food - TBD (food for purchase - Boy Scouts?, Rotary?, Rustic Boutique Catering  
food truck?)  
· Parking (Scott checking on use of Van - Job Lot parking?)
